Now open: domestic abuse one-stop shop

Our weekly domestic abuse one stop shop offers women a safe and confidential space to receive specialist advice, information, support and signposting around domestic abuse.

Held every Monday from 10am to 12pm at the Women’s Resource Centre (Nari Centre) at 61 Vallance Road, the sessions brings together key council teams and partner agencies.

Service users can speak with trauma-informed specialists, police representatives, housing officers, legal professionals and other support services in one place.

Tower Hamlets Housing Options

If you are at risk of homelessness because of domestic abuse, you can approach Housing Options. Housing Options have an on-site Independent Domestic Violence Advocate (IDVA) on-site who can provide you with one-to-one support, which could include making a safety plan, informing you of your housing rights, supporting you to report incidents to police or providing ongoing emotional support.
